Vladimir Salamun in ‘Farm to Table’ at Allan Stone Projects

Vladimir Salamun’s marble ice cream scoop stars in a deliciously food-themed show at Allan Stone Projects. Monumental and crafted in traditional art materials, this slow-to-melt pop art monument to the pleasures of taste becomes a treat for the eye as well. (On view in Chelsea through August 11th).

Vladimir Salamun, Strawberry Scoop, bronze, carved wood and marble, 26 ½ x 12 x 12 inches, 2007.

Don Nice at Allan Stone Projects

This oil on canvas rabbit from 1968 by Pop painter Don Nice shares wall space with a muffin and a chocolate glazed donut at Allan Stone Projects, but at almost four feet high, dare not be considered as dinner. Instead, like a nearby duck or a careful watercolor rendering of an onion, its isolation on the canvas is a bold statement of the here and now. (In Chelsea through April 22nd).

Don Nice, Rabbit, oil on canvas, 43 x 90 inches, 1968.
